Function⁢ and Role of the Spray Arm Assembly in Whirlpool Dishwasher Water⁣ Distribution

The⁣ 285006 whirlpool Spray is a spray arm assembly that directs pressurized circulation water into controlled jets to achieve‍ even ⁣coverage across the dish racks.‌ The component converts pump‍ output into directional sprays via molded nozzle ports and either reaction-driven rotation (jet reaction torque) or an internal turbine ⁤coupling, depending on⁢ the specific assembly design. Water distribution performance is governed by nozzle orifice size, the open cross-sectional area of the ports, ⁢the integrity of the arm geometry, and unobstructed rotation; damaged arms, ⁤blocked orifices, or an incompatible hub/mounting ⁢style will change jet trajectories and reduce‌ cleaning effectiveness. Always‍ verify fit by part number and hub type before installing a replacement‍ to ensure the arm matches the tub layout and circulation pump characteristics of the machine.

  • Common observable behaviors: uneven coverage, poor soil ⁣removal,‌ loud or erratic rotation, and visible wobble or interference with racks.
  • Inspection​ steps: check nozzle bores for deposits, ensure free rotation on the shaft, inspect for cracks or warpage, and confirm ⁤retainer/clip engagement.
  • Compatibility checkpoints: match spline/hub diameter, retainer style, and ‌nozzle orientation to the original assembly.

Troubleshooting should proceed from the spray arm outward: clear orifices and confirm the arm rotates freely before attributing poor wash performance to⁣ the pump or electronic controls. if nozzles are clear but rotation is minimal, measure downstream pressure at the pump or inspect​ the diverter/valve that⁣ feeds the spray ​arm;​ slow rotation with adequate pressure ‍frequently enough indicates worn mounting bushings or a warped arm that needs replacement. For service situations,replacing a compromised spray​ arm with the correct part​ restores the designed jet pattern‌ and coverage only if the⁢ replacement matches the original mounting and nozzle configuration and the circulation pump is producing expected‌ flow⁤ and pressure.

How the 285006 Whirlpool spray Operates Within the appliance:‍ Wash‑Cycle Hydraulics and⁣ Nozzle Dynamics

the ​285006 Whirlpool Spray functions as a hydraulically driven nozzle assembly that converts pressurized wash-pump flow into directed jets ⁢and rotational torque for the spray arm. Wash water is fed from the pump into the appliance manifold and through the spray assembly’s internal passages; the combination⁣ of passage geometry, orifice diameter and backpressure ⁢determines ​jet velocity, spray ⁣angle, and droplet size. The nozzle dynamics also ‍create the reactive forces that rotate the arm-unequal ‌or blocked ports change torque balance and reduce rotation speed, which lowers impingement⁤ energy ​on ‍dishes. In practical terms, the part’s mounting interface, inlet port size and orifice pattern must match the dishwasher’s manifold and spray-arm shaft to ‌preserve the intended hydraulic behavior.

Operational compatibility and troubleshooting focus on flow path integrity and nozzle condition rather than electronic control. Typical performance⁢ issues that ⁢trace to ‍the‍ spray assembly include reduced cleaning energy, zonal coverage gaps, and noisy or stalled arm rotation; these are commonly caused by mineral deposits in orifices, erosive widening of spray ​holes, or leaking seals that ‌change internal flow distribution. Technicians should verify that the spray arm spins freely when supplied with nominal pump ​flow,inspect orifices for asymmetric wear,and confirm sealing​ surfaces and snap-fit features ⁢match the replacement part. Replacement units labeled as the same part number will generally preserve nozzle geometry and mounting dimensions, but confirm physical match to avoid altered spray‌ patterns‍ or ‍hydraulic losses.

  • Symptoms: slow/no rotation, spotty wash coverage, visible nozzle blockage, abnormal noise.
  • Key checks: ​free rotation under flow, orifice cleanliness, inlet/mounting dimension match.
  • Common fixes: clear orifices, replace worn spray arm/nozzle assembly, verify pump pressure and seals.

Common Failure Symptoms and Diagnostic indicators of‍ Spray Arm Wear, Blockage,‌ or Imbalance

The spray​ arm is a precision hydraulic component that converts pressurized flow from the dishwasher pump into rotating, distributed jets that remove food ‌soils. The 285006 Whirlpool Spray is a direct-replacement style spray arm‌ designed for that role:⁢ its jet orifices,bearing surface,and mounting interface determine spray pattern,rotational balance,and compatibility⁤ with ⁢the dishwasher’s‍ pump and rack geometry.Wear commonly appears as enlarged or eroded orifices, axial play at the bearing or hub, hairline cracks in the arm body, or deformations that⁢ change ‌the jet angles; each failure mode alters the ⁢flow distribution and reduces cleaning efficacy even when ‍pump pressure appears⁣ normal. Verify model-specific fit before installation because small differences in jet size or mounting can⁢ change system ‍behavior and clearance to spray racks or⁢ silverware baskets.

technicians and owners can distinguish wear, blockage, and imbalance by observing performance and performing a few targeted checks. Typical ⁢diagnostic steps include a visual inspection for clogged jets and cracks, spinning the arm by hand to feel for rough bearings or excessive play, and running⁤ a short cycle while watching for continuous rotation and symmetric spray⁤ delivery. Listen ⁤for repetitive knocking or a steady vibration (indicating imbalance or contact with racks), and⁣ map residue patterns on dishes – persistent soiling in the⁣ same zones usually indicates blocked or misdirected jets. Before replacing the spray arm, ‌clear deposits with a thin probe or descaling soak to⁣ confirm whether cleaning restores performance; ​if rotation remains irregular or the arm shows structural damage, replacement is indicated.

  • Reduced cleaning or persistent food residue concentrated in a band or sector.
  • Intermittent or no ​rotation of ‌the arm during a cycle despite normal pump noise.
  • Abnormal noises (thumping, buzzing, or scraping) during ​operation.
  • Visible ⁢buildup in jet holes, cracked‌ arm sections, or ⁣excessive​ side-to-side play at the hub.

Compatibility, Replacement Considerations, and Step‑by‑Step Installation Procedures for the Spray Arm

The spray arm 285006 Whirlpool Spray is a ‌rotating distribution component that translates pressurized wash water‍ from the dishwasher pump into a​ controlled⁢ spray pattern⁢ across the load. Its mechanical interface -‍ typically a splined or keyed hub with either a ‌retaining clip or threaded nut – determines compatibility with specific Whirlpool, Maytag, and KitchenAid models. Compatibility depends⁢ on mating-post diameter,⁣ spline count/profile, retaining method, overall arm length, and nozzle⁤ geometry; technicians should confirm ⁤those dimensions and the hub style on the ‌existing unit rather‍ than relying solely on model lists. The⁤ arm’s behavior in service is governed by hydraulic balance and low-friction mounting surfaces: worn bushings, clogged nozzles, or a damaged hub will reduce rotation speed and change spray distribution, producing the⁤ common symptoms of poor cleaning or incomplete rinsing.

When replacing the spray arm, verify that the replacement matches the original mounting interface and nozzle orientation and replace any sealing washers or worn retaining hardware rather than reusing degraded parts. For installation, remove the lower⁤ rack, isolate electrical power (turn off breaker) and ensure the sump area is drained of debris, then remove the retaining clip or ⁣nut, clear obstructions⁤ from the post and distributor, press the new arm onto the hub aligning splines, and resecure the ‍fastener without over-torquing plastic ‍components.After assembly, manually rotate the arm to confirm free movement, run a short diagnostic or ‌quick-wash cycle, ‌and ⁣inspect for ‌proper rotation, spray coverage, and ⁣leaks; if rotation is absent despite correct fit, inspect the distributor/pump outlet for stripped splines, obstructions,⁢ or a failed ⁤drive‍ coupling.

  • Step 1: Cut power at the breaker and pull out the lower rack for access.
  • Step 2: Remove retaining clip or nut and lift off the old spray arm; inspect post, seal, and‌ collector hub for wear.
  • Step 3: Fit the replacement 285006 Whirlpool Spray aligning splines or key,‌ replace seal if present, and secure the retainer hand-tight.
  • Step 4: Manually spin‌ the arm,run a short test cycle,then check for rotation,spray coverage,and leaks.

Q&A

What is Whirlpool part 285006?

Whirlpool part 285006 is a dishwasher spray arm assembly – the rotating plastic arm with nozzles that distributes pressurized wash water inside ‍the tub. It’s an internal‌ component used on certain⁢ Whirlpool-family dishwashers to ensure even water coverage during cycles.

How do I know if the 285006 spray arm is failing?

Common signs of failure include poor cleaning results, food residue remaining‍ on ​dishes, the ‍arm not spinning, visible‍ cracks or broken nozzles, or the ⁣arm wobbling on its mount. Also check for clogs ‍in the arm jets or a damaged hub/bearing that prevents free ⁤rotation.

Can I clean the 285006 spray arm and how should I do it?

Yes.‌ Remove the spray arm (see your model’s removal method), soak it in warm soapy water, and use a soft brush ⁣or toothpick to clear out nozzle holes. Rinse thoroughly⁣ and inspect ​for cracks or wear. Clean the⁣ spray arm inlet and the hub in the dishwasher where it mounts before⁣ reinstalling.

How‌ do I replace the 285006 spray arm⁣ – are tools required?

Replacement is usually straightforward: turn​ off power (or⁢ switch the dishwasher off), remove racks as ‌needed, and unclip or unscrew the spray arm retaining nut or⁣ cap (some models⁤ are snap-fit).Remove the old arm, fit the new arm onto the hub, secure the retaining piece, replace racks, and run a short cycle to test. You may need⁢ a screwdriver or wrench for models that use a retaining screw or nut.

Is part 285006 compatible‍ with my Whirlpool dishwasher model?

Compatibility depends on your exact dishwasher model. Confirm compatibility by checking your dishwasher’s model number (usually⁤ on the door frame) and cross-referencing it with⁣ the parts diagram on‌ Whirlpool’s‌ website or a trusted parts supplier. Don’t⁣ rely solely on visual similarity – use the model number lookup for accuracy.

Should I buy⁢ OEM 285006 or ​will an‌ aftermarket arm work?

OEM parts match original fit and materials ⁢and are recommended for best reliability.Quality aftermarket⁣ arms can ‍work and are often less expensive, but ensure the part ‌explicitly‍ lists compatibility with your ‍dishwasher model and includes the ‌correct mounting hardware. Return policies and warranties are also worth checking.

Any ⁢tips after installation or preventative maintenance for the⁢ 285006?

After installing, run a short rinse cycle to ⁢verify the arm ‍spins freely and ther are no leaks. Regular maintenance: clean food traps/filters, clear nozzle holes periodically, avoid ⁢overloading the rack, ⁤and check the arm’s hub and retaining clip for wear. Replace the spray arm if you find⁤ cracks, persistent clogs that won’t clean, or a damaged bearing.
